Bunyan

[n] a legendary giant lumberjack of the north woods of the United States and Canada; had a blue ox named Babe; "the lakes of Minnesota began when Paul Bunyan and Babe's footprints filled with water"
[n] English preacher and author of an allegorical novel, Pilgrim's Progress (1628-1688)
